The age old question continues – how does one become a professional athlete? When it comes to soccer, the path is not always clear, but one thing is for certain, youth camps and youth soccer clinics are a surefire way to receive high-level training by legendary coaches, managers, and even professional clubs.
Let’s take a look at all the professional soccer clubs that host youth soccer clinics. Will you join?
Gotham FC
Gotham FC Youth – Gotham FC Youth hosts both clinics and summer camps to focus on technique and player development. Our own GSN Ambassador FiFi Garcia, called a soccer “genius” by coaches, just received overall MVP with the youth club.
Portland Thorns FC
Portland Thorns FC – The Thorns considers their youth clinic a “pathway to the pros” and offers competitive and high level training with Portland Thorns FC Academy coaches.
Bay FC
Bay FC – Bay FC and sponsor Sutter Health host youth soccer clinics and couple soccer skill sessions with mental health training to ensure players are well on and off the soccer pitch.
Angel City FC
Angel City FC – ACFC hosts a youth summer camp to “train like the pros” and learn the methodology and skills honed by ACFC. Their focus on community building and youth development is an Angel City specialty.
Racing Louisville FC
Racing Louisville FC – Racing Louisville and Louisville City FC join together for the “LouCity and Racing Foundation” to host clinics for kids. Clinics focus on skills-building and technical abilities in an inclusive, community-centered environment.
PSG Academy
PSG Academy (Paris Saint-Germain) is an exceptional club run out of Los Angeles and considered one of the most elite clubs available. The club “ also offers international exposure and direct pathways to reach the next level,” according to the website, and specializes in training players in their specific methodology.
NC Courage
NC Courage – NC Courage and North Carolina FC partnered together to host “North Carolina Youth,” an ECNL academy focused on high-level, elite training with a professional pathway.
Houston Dash
Houston Dash – Houston Dash Youth is a training program committed to pathways to collegiate soccer, with 100 percent of their 2021 and 2023 class participants committed to college, making the program ranked number one in the nation for national college commitments.
Seattle Reign
Seattle Reign – The Reign has a year-round club, Reign Academy, that focuses “first on developing extraordinary people, not players.” Their female-centric focus also means all coaches are women, signaling the first youth club in the region led by all women. The Reign Academy also focuses on connection to the professional club, by having several Reign players serve as assistant coaches.
LA Galaxy
LA Galaxy – Beyond just women’s professional teams, Galaxy also hosts a co-ed training camp to fit all ages and all skill levels.
